Japan Airlines Updates International Network Plan through September 30, 2021
(Press Memo - For Immediate Release)
Japan Airlines (JAL) announced additional revisions to its international network plans through September 30, 2021. This revision includes international destinations, which were not included during the previous announcement on April 1. Updates include routes to Taipei, Kaohsiung, Hawaii and Guam through the end of September and flights to China, Hong Kong, Korea and Vladivostok for the month of July 2021.
Based on the Company`s new medium term management plan released today, Japan Airlines made the decision to suspend scheduled service between Narita=Busan and Narita=Kaohsiung. In addition, the carrier will reduce service between Narita=Honolulu and Narita=Taipei (TPE), suspend the launch of the Narita=Chicago O`Hare route, as well as canceling plans to add a second daily flight between Narita=Guam.
The carrier will continue to review travel restrictions within each destination and update its international network plan, while asking for our customer`s understanding during this unprecedented time.
